First off, let’s talk about what a marine environment means. It’s not just about being near the water; it’s a whole different ball game. The air is filled with salt particles, the humidity is off the charts, and there are all kinds of temperature changes. These conditions can be really tough on equipment, and fan and blower components are no exception.
The salt in the air can cause some serious corrosion. Saltwater is like a super – annoying chemical that eats away at metal over time. If a fan or blower component is made of regular metal and isn’t protected, it’s gonna start rusting pretty quickly. You know how an old metal fence by the beach gets all flaky and rusty? The same thing can happen to our components.
Humidity is another big headache. When there’s a lot of moisture in the air, it can lead to mold and mildew growth. That’s not just gross; it can also mess up the performance of the components. For example, if the fan blades start to collect mold, they can become unbalanced. An unbalanced fan blade means the fan won’t work as smoothly and efficiently as it should.
And then there are the temperature changes. On a sunny day at sea, it can get really hot, and at night, it can drop to a much cooler temperature. These constant shifts can cause materials to expand and contract. If the components aren’t made of the right materials or aren’t designed to handle these changes, they might crack or break.

Our axial fans are great for marine applications. They’re designed to move a large volume of air in a straight line. In a marine environment, they can be used for ventilation in cabins, engine rooms, and storage areas. The special coatings on the fan blades and housing protect them from salt and moisture, so they can keep working effectively for a long time.
Centrifugal blowers are another popular choice. They’re really good at creating high – pressure airflow, which is useful for things like air – intake systems in boats. The impellers in our centrifugal blowers are made from corrosion – resistant materials, so they can handle the harsh marine conditions without getting worn out.
We also offer a range of filters for our fans and blowers. These filters are important in a marine environment because they can trap salt particles, dust, and other contaminants before they reach the components. This helps to extend the life of the fans and blowers and keeps them running smoothly.
